Regular Season Round 9: Tsmoki-Minsk - GOCOR-Sozh 94-30
Date: November 10, 2017
An interesting game for Tsmoki-Minsk (9-0) which hosted in Minsk 4th placed GOCOR-Sozh (5-4). Leader Tsmoki-Minsk had an easy win 94-30. The game without a history. Tsmoki-Minsk led from the first minutes and controlled entire game increasing their lead in each quarter. They dominated on the defensive end, holding GOCOR-Sozh to just 4 points in second quarter and to 12 points in second half. Tsmoki-Minsk dominated down low during the game scoring 58 of its points in the paint compared to GOCOR-Sozh's 22. Tsmoki-Minsk forced 35 GOCOR-Sozh turnovers and outrebounded them 46-26 including a 16-3 advantage in offensive rebounds. Tsmoki-Minsk looked well-organized offensively handing out 28 assists comparing to just 2 passes made by GOCOR-Sozh's players. It was a good game for the former international forward Aliaksandr Semianiuk (208-93) who led his team to a victory with 15 points, 5 rebounds, 8 assists and 6 steals. Forward Maksim Sazonau (202-96) contributed with 19 points for the winners. Four Tsmoki-Minsk players scored in double figures. Tsmoki-Minsk's coach Aleksander Krutikov felt very confident that he used 10 players which allowed the starters a little rest for the next games. Swingman Daniil Adaskov (193-96) answered with 14 points and forward Alexei Kovalev (-0) added 1 points and 10 rebounds in the effort for GOCOR-Sozh. Tsmoki-Minsk have an impressive series of nine victories in a row. Defending champion keeps a position of league leader, which they share with COR-Borisfen and Grodno-93. GOCOR-Sozh at the other side keeps the fourth place with four games lost. Tsmoki-Minsk is again looking forward to face GOCOR-Sozh (#4) in Gomel in the next round. GOCOR-Sozh will have a break next round.
